Mar 02, 2009 (newstodate): Slovenian carrier Adria Airways has been forced to cut back on its route network due to the low demand during the current world economic crisis.
The carrier's planned flights from Ljubljana to new destination Sofia, Bulgaria, due to be launched from March 30, 2009, have been suspended, and flights to Oslo, Norway have already been stopped.
The planned launch of a new route from Ljubljana to Madrid, Spain, from March 30, 2009, is however still in the plans, sources say.
